Autumn – getting the garden ready for Winter

Autumn can be a busy time in the garden, we have some great tips to make your life easier!

Set the cutters of the lawn mower high and use it to collect leaves off the lawn. It’s quicker than brushing them up.

Cover the pool with a fine net to prevent leaves blowing in.

Remove old leaves and weeds from the herbaceous border; it’s where the slugs and snails hide. If the area is small surface the bed with coarse grit. It will deter slugs and open up the surface allowing water to drain away.

Turn over piles of garden debris before burning to make sure there are no hedgehogs about to hibernate in the base. Leave a few small heaps under hedges to attract them.

There are lots of seeds which can be saved now from plants in your garden. Poppy, foxglove, aconite and verbascum produce thousands of seeds which, if sown, will flower next year.
